Druckerschwärze
printer's ink
noun DROOK-er-shvairt-se Rare
Origin: from Drucker (printer) + Schwärze (blackness)
Usage Note
Druckerschwärze is the black ink used in printing presses, often evoked metaphorically for the print press itself. The compound contains Schwärze from schwarz (black). Usually singular.
Examples
"Die frische Zeitung roch noch nach Druckerschwärze."
Natural Translation
The fresh newspaper still smelled of printer's ink.
Literal Translation
The fresh newspaper smelled still of printer's-ink.
